“Loved this little Inn”
4 of 5 stars Reviewed 16 October 2011
3
people found this review helpful

After check in the lovely girl at the front desk , I think her name was "Lila" approached us in the parking lot and offered to update our room to a King with a peek ocean view!
I was over the moon to receive this upgrade to say the least.. The room was on the small side but worked fine fir us, it was also tastefully decorated. The bed was a tad uncomfortable for me, I'm not sure if it was a cheap mattress or just old..
It could be easily remedied with a foam mattress topper if management was interested in improving the comfort of the bed without replacing it.
There is a small bar and restaurant which was convenient for a nightcap and breakfast. You get a $10 discount on breakfast.
I would stay here again in a heartbeat!

Room Tip: We had room 24 close to the pool with a peek ocean view. perfect

I am a tall man 6'3"; my legs touched the wall when I sat on the toilet. Place is VERY old and the shower stall is VERY small. It was hot in the bedroom, no a/c but there was a ceiling fan.
We got bed bugs on our 10 day stay in Calif. perhaps we got them here or at our other hotel, not sure. so be warned.

“Decent value”
4 of 5 stars Reviewed 19 September 2011 via mobile

Location was good with easy access to Santa Barbara coast. Room was small but manageable. Parking tight with a $3 fee. Price was decent value with $5 credit per person at restaurant next door. Worked well for our overnight stay.
